Meet the faces behind the infamous Instagram account @genderless_nipples

Their first account was deleted over a male nipple

If you’re not already following genderless_nipples, then you’re probably not on Instagram.

“We know there are times when people might want to share nude images that are artistic or creative in nature, but for a variety of reasons, we don’t allow nudity,” Instagram outlined in the most recent update to its guidelines section.

But this glorious account is working to change all of that. Full of gender-indistinguishable nipples, it aims to hi-light the incongruity in rules related to gender on social media.

So we reached out to ask them how it’s going.

Can you tell us a little about the people behind the account?

We are three advertising students who interned together in NY from October-December last year.

Evelyne Wyss (24, Swiss/Dutch, Copywriter), Morgan-Lee Wagner (22, German, Copywriter) and Marco Russo (28, Brazillian, Art-Director).

We are from Miami Ad School Europe, Miami Ad School Berlin and Miami Ad School NY.

From left to right: Evelyne Wyss, Marco Russo, Morgan-Lee Wagner

Why did you all decide to start it?

We started interning in New York shortly before the elections. During that period, so many horrible things were said by candidates, and their supporters, about women’s rights and gender equality, that we decided we should do something about it. And what better way to start spreading a message of gender equality then by pointing out the rules of social networks?

Regardless of gender, everybody should be treated equally.

Are you opposed to Instagram’s rules?

We are not against the rules, but we think rules should be applied to all genders equally. Society is changing and it’s time for the rules to follow this behavior.

We thought that without men’s hair around the nipple, how could Instagram even tell the difference. We want to show Instagram that their policy is not working in today’s society anymore.

Did you expect it to get as big as it has?

No. Especially because our first account was hacked and deleted by Instagram. Insta deleted a nipple saying it was against community guidelines. Ironically it was a male nipple.

But we reacted instantly and put up a new account — our current one. Then it picked up so quickly we realized it was going to be a bigger project.

It became a bit of a full-time job next to our internships. We’re so grateful people are listening to us. It’s incredible how everyone participates!

What’s the end goal?

We wanted to spark a conversation — get people talking and thinking about it. We’re still hoping for a reaction from Instagram; we want to start a friendly open dialogue with them.

We want to challenge people’s perception of what is sexual, and what actually might not be it at all. It works, people are guessing the gender and all the guesses are different under each photo.

60-70% of all guesses are wrong — proving our point.
